可靠度工程师招聘面试题与参考回答2025年.docx

可靠度工程师招聘面试题与参考回答2025年.docx

  1. 1、本文档共15页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

2025年招聘可靠度工程师面试题与参考回答

面试问答题(总共10个问题)

第一题

请解释可靠性工程中的“可靠度”与“可用性”之间的区别,并举例说明两者在实际工程项目中的重要性。

参考回答:

可靠度(Reliability)是指产品或系统在规定的条件和时间内,完成预定功能的能力。它主要关注的是产品在无故障状态下运行的概率,通常以一段时间内不发生故障的比例来衡量。例如,一个硬盘制造商可能会声明其产品在五年内的可靠度为99.9%,意味着在这五年期间,硬盘能够正常工作的概率为99.9%。

可用性(Availability)则是一个更广泛的概念,它不仅包括了系统的可靠度,还考虑到了系统从故障中恢复的速度,即系统的可维护性和维修时间。可用性是系统处于可操作和可提供所需性能水平的时间比例,通常用MTBF(平均故障间隔时间)和MTTR(平均修复时间)来评估。例如,在数据中心环境中,服务器的可用性可能被要求达到“五个九”,即99.999%,这表示一年中服务不可用的时间不超过几秒钟。

解析:

可靠度和可用性都是可靠性工程的重要组成部分,但它们侧重点不同。可靠度更多地强调预防故障的发生,而可用性则是在考虑如何快速有效地应对故障,确保系统尽可能长时间地保持在线和功能性。因此,在设计和开发过程中,工程师需要同时优化这两个方面,以确保最终产品的质量和用户体验。

举例来说,在航空工业中,飞机的可靠度至关重要,因为任何飞行中的故障都可能导致灾难性的后果。因此,制造商们投入大量资源来提高飞机各部件的可靠度。然而,一旦出现故障,快速修复并使飞机重新投入使用也非常重要,这就涉及到可用性的概念。航空公司会建立完善的维护和支持体系,以便尽快处理任何问题,从而不影响航班安排和客户满意度。

第二题:

请描述一个您在之前的工作中遇到的复杂问题,并详细说明您是如何分析问题、提出解决方案并最终解决问题的过程。

答案:

在我之前的工作中,我曾遇到过一个复杂的问题:我们公司的一款核心软件在多用户并发访问时频繁出现崩溃现象,导致用户体验极差。以下是我在这个问题的解决过程中的具体步骤:

问题分析:

收集崩溃前后的系统日志和用户反馈,初步判断问题可能与内存泄漏或线程冲突有关。

使用性能监控工具对系统进行实时监控,发现崩溃时内存占用迅速升高,并伴随CPU使用率飙升。

解决方案提出:

设计了一个内存泄漏检测工具,对软件进行持续监控,定位可能的内存泄漏点。

分析代码,发现多个线程在处理用户请求时存在竞态条件,导致数据不一致。

实施解决方案:

针对内存泄漏,通过优化代码逻辑,减少不必要的内存分配,并定期清理不再使用的资源。

针对线程冲突,采用线程锁和同步机制,确保数据的一致性和线程安全。

测试与验证:

在开发环境中模拟多用户并发访问,验证优化后的软件性能。

在生产环境中逐步推广新版本,持续监控软件运行状态,确保问题得到解决。

总结与反馈:

对此次问题解决过程进行总结,记录经验教训,以便团队在以后的工作中避免类似问题。

向团队分享解决方案和经验,提高团队的技术水平。

解析:

这道题目考察的是应聘者的问题解决能力、分析能力以及团队协作能力。通过描述一个具体的问题解决案例,应聘者可以展示以下能力:

分析问题的能力:能够从多角度分析问题,找出问题的根源。

解决问题的能力:能够提出有效的解决方案,并付诸实施。

沟通与协作能力:能够与团队成员沟通,分享经验,共同提高。

第三题

在可靠度工程中,如何定义“故障模式影响分析(FMEA)”?请详细解释其流程,并说明它在产品开发周期中的作用。此外,请举例说明FMEA是如何帮助改善产品的可靠性的。

答案:

故障模式影响分析(FailureModesandEffectsAnalysis,FMEA)是一种预防性分析方法,用于识别可能的故障模式、确定每种故障模式的影响以及评估检测这些故障模式的能力。FMEA是可靠度工程中的一个重要工具,旨在通过系统化的方式减少或消除潜在的故障点,从而提高产品或过程的可靠性。

FMEA的基本流程包括以下几个步骤:

组建团队:选择一个具有多学科背景的团队,确保涵盖所有必要的专业知识。

定义范围:明确FMEA将覆盖的产品或过程部分。

识别故障模式:列出每一个组件或子系统所有可能的故障方式。

分析故障原因和机制:对于每个故障模式,识别可能导致该故障的原因及其背后的物理或化学机制。

评估影响:根据严重性、发生频率和可探测性对每个故障模式进行评分。

采取行动:基于风险优先数(RPN),决定需要采取哪些设计或工艺上的改进措施来降低风险。

记录结果:更新FMEA文档,记录所有的发现和行动计划。

持续改进:随着更多数据的积累和经验教训的总结,定期回顾并更新FMEA。

FMEA在产品开发周期中的作用:

它可以在设计阶段早期识别出潜在的问题,使得工程师

文档评论(0)

jnswk +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档